Steven "Steve'' John Hammer, 50, of Duluth, died Monday, Sept. 1, 2008, in St. Mary's Hospice. Steve was born in Marshall, Minn., on April 17, 1958, to William and Nellie (Nelson) Hammer. He was a former Auto Detailer. Steve moved to Duluth in 1999. Steve was a member of the Minnesota epilepsy association. He liked to fish and was a photographer. He is preceded in death by his parents; his sister, Joann Gilb; and his brother, Daniel Hammer. Steve is survived by his brother, William of Duluth; three sisters, Kay (Robert) Fiedler of Clear Lake, Minn., Joyce (Norbert) DeMeyer of Brooklyn Park, Minn., and Deborah (Douglas) Campbell of Minneapolis and his special friend, Nicole Berg of Duluth. Internment will be at the Marshall Cemetery in Marshall, Minn.
